Output c8560d1031338642af18f302e2445a0f073d9cc6aaeb5a12da8c7c41f56bea60:14

value
5288000
script pubkey
OP_0 OP_PUSHBYTES_20 b1697b34c7054daf0692f3598cbdf1af9a18ac58
address
bc1qk95hkdx8q4x67p5j7dvce00347dp3tzc4qzzx4
transaction
c8560d1031338642af18f302e2445a0f073d9cc6aaeb5a12da8c7c41f56bea60